RST Software is a Polish custom software development shop founded in the late 1990s (20+ years in operation). The company has 180+ regular and senior engineers spread across its operations. It works with startups and established companies to build MVPs, SaaS products, web and mobile applications, and handles cloud infrastructure and process automation. Clients include Kitche (food waste app), CarFellows (car rental e-commerce), EasyTranslate (translation platform), and City Pantry (UK-based food ordering). The company maintains a portfolio of 20+ case studies across industries ranging from fintech to mobility-as-a-service.

Services and capabilities

RST breaks its offering into several buckets. MVP development—their stated focus—covers product workshop (1-2 days), wireframing (4-7 days), UX/UI design (7-14 days), MVP build (2-6 months), and launch-day support. They estimate MVP timelines from two to six months and costs from $40,000 to $300,000+. SaaS development includes strategy consulting, custom builds, architecture design, integration, QA, and deployment. They offer dedicated SaaS cloud services: cloud migration, security, infrastructure design, serverless computing, performance optimization, containerization.

Location-based services form a vertical specialty—they work with map platforms (OpenStreetMap, Mapbox), geospatial mapping, and spatial data visualization. They also build chat apps, video streaming platforms, and logistics software. Process automation is handled through Camunda Platform (BPM) implementation. Web stack covers React, Next.js, Nuxt.js; mobile includes React Native and Flutter; backend includes Node.js, PHP, Java; cloud includes AWS and GCP.

Delivery methodology centers on Scrum-oriented teams. Project managers and developers report directly; a dedicated Agile PM is available daily. Budget oversight and schedule accountability are stated commitments. QA specialists are assigned during development. They promise demos and PM reports throughout.

How they work

For MVP projects, the process is structured: begin with a product workshop to align vision and identify technical risks; move to wireframes and clickable prototypes (days, not months, they claim); proceed to UX/UI and specs; then development with a QA specialist embedded. For longer engagements, they offer staff augmentation (regular and senior engineers), SaaS consulting, or dedicated team models. Pricing is project-dependent (MVP estimates noted above); for SaaS, no standard rate card is listed—engagement is scoped post-consultation. Communication is handled via Agile rituals and direct team access. Clients own all source code and deliverables upon completion, including design assets and documentation.

Team and credentials

RST has 180+ engineers (regular and senior level). Founded in the late 1990s, so roughly 25+ years in operation per their own reference. They are an official AWS partner and AWS-certified solution architects. They hold Camunda Gold Partner certification. Certified Kubernetes DevOps team. They maintain open-source projects: AdminJS (37,969 weekly downloads on npm, described as the top open-source admin panel for Node.js); also Eventrix and BetterDocs. The company was named one of Poland's fastest-growing companies. No ISO 27001, SOC 2, or GDPR compliance claims are mentioned in the source, though data security is referenced in partnership context with cloud providers.
